Phillip Bank offers a wide range of financial services and products catering to Corporate, SME, and Retail customers. It is a member of PhillipCapital Group which is headquartered in Singapore, and established since 1975. The Group offers a full range of quality and innovative services to retail, corporate and institutional customers and currently operates in over 15 countries including Australia, Cambodia, China (as well as Hong Kong), France, India, Indonesia, Japan, Malaysia, Singapore, Thailand, Turkey, UK, UAE, USA and Vietnam.

We were established in Cambodia in 2009 under HwangDBS Commercial Bank Plc. and in 2014, PhillipCapital Group bought it over and renamed it as Phillip Bank. In year 2020, the merger between Phillip Bank Plc. and KREDIT Microfinance Institution Plc. concluded successfully and made us one of the largest commercial bank with more than 70 branches in Cambodia.

Relationship Manager

Position Summary

Department/ Branch: Chbar Ampov, Kamboul, Kampot, and Preah Sihanouk Branch

Expectations - Duties, Responsibilities
  • Support branches to drive growth in the bank's products and services, especially to support branches to grow the deposit & Non-Loan targets by buildup networking/pipeline/potential Business owner’s across region.
  • Ensure that all branches under own region are profit, grow banking business from year to year, and maintain good loan quality.
  • Mentor, coach and support Branch Managers, helping them to be successful and fulfilled producers and leaders.
  • Provide leadership, accountability and support to Branch Managers in completion of the annual Branch Assessment and Planning Tool.
  • Manage the sales and service operations.
  • Manage Loan Quality consist of controlling collection and default solving.
  • Support the branches evaluate and process MSME/SME loans.
  • Coordinate effective staff coverage within assigned region.
  • Plan, organize and deliver effective regional meetings and other training as necessary.
  • Reduce error and improve audit finding.
  • Maintain effective, positive relationships with branch managers and other staff by consistent in-branch visits, phone calls and email correspondence.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by Executive Management.
Requirements - Skills, Qualifications, Experience
  • Degree holders in Business/ Finance preferred
  • Minimum 5-8 years of relevant supervisory experience in sales & service operations
  • Ability to understand business functions such as marketing, sales, finance, HR etc.
  • Good knowledge of financial analysis, loans securitization and loans asset supervision abilities
  • Good time management and effective leadership skills.
 
 

Lending Specialist, SME

Position Summary

Department/ Branch: Monivong, Chbar Ampov, Norodom, Teuk Thla, Mean Chey, Kampot, Kampong Cham, and Paoy Paet Branch

Expectations - Duties, Responsibilities
  • Acquires new SME borrower and grow SME loan book at the branch
  • Evaluate loan applications and submit a comprehensive analyzed credit memo.
  • Ensure that bank’s credit principles and policies are followed and complied.
  • Ensure that deviations from the bank’s credit management processes/procedures/policies are identified and properly addressed.
  • Collect supporting documents from borrowers for the loan applications and to verify the repayment sources of income.
  • Conduct site visits and inspections where necessary to verify the applications and attend meeting with borrowers to discuss loan proposals to understand their businesses.
  • Make sound recommendations based on quality analysis and ensure timely submission of the credit memos for approval.
  • Response to queries raised by Credit Risk Management Team on the loan applications
  • Monitor the loans review date and ensure prompt review of loans.
  • Monitor progressive loans and post-disbursement conditions to ensure compliance of conditions imposed.
  • Ensure proper filing of documents for the Corporate Borrowers.
  • Liaising and follow up with CAD for the issuance of LO and loans releases.
Requirements - Skills, Qualifications, Experience
  • Bachelor degree in banking and finance or related file
  • At least 3 years of experience in Banking 
  • Skills/knowledge in Loan processing and Sales
  • Ability to acquires loan and deposit customer
  • Sound written and verbal English communication skills. Chinese Speaking is an additional advantage
  • Computer Skills (Ms. Word, Excel, and Power Point).
